I've read a complaint that Force Bubble will draw aggro from baddies out of your LOS. You might draw in a group of enemies from the next hallway, instigating a fight with multiple mobs. Sounds like the Bubble does a pretty awesome job keeping them at bay, but let me know if you run into this being an issue.

I don't plan on doing any PvP (well, maybe for kicks someday), so you are dead-on correct there. I can't imagine getting in so much trouble that I would need to use my 'panic button' that often.
Honestly? I use it most for three things- when traveling, so I don't accidently get smacked by some big bad I came too close to, my panic button so I can run away without being too concerned about taking a 300 point shot to the back of my head, and if I'm soloing and come into an area where the baddies are waiting for me. I had to wait until I had it to complete a couple missions where I was ambushed as soon as I came in the door.
